I have been in the dsm world for over 13 years now, and I drive a next to mint condition 1991 Galant vr4 # 222/2000. The motor is a stock rebuild.

So I am having a pretty crazy issue I have been trying to figure out for a while now. My Vr4 starts and idles just fine however, when I start driving, it starts breaking up and will NOT rev past 2k rpms until I shut the car off and restart it. once restarted it idles fine until I start driving again.

So what I have done to figure out whats going on. Replaced my plugs with BP7res NGK plugs, gapped to .28 New plug wires, replaced transistor, Compression test as follows, 152, 150, 154, 154. Timing is dead on marks on the cam gears and crank line up at 5* base. New denso o2 sensor (just replaced yesterday) and boost leak tested at 20psi, Found some leaks but they are all fixed now.

This all started after I replaced my clutch (ACT 2600 PP and street disc) and 8lb. Fidanza flywheel. I really thought this issue was my o2 sensor not cycling, So I replaced the o2 and its finally cycling again. But it has not fixed the issue at all. Any insight would be great. My computer won't link up to my logger so I cant post a log as of now.


Main mods are as follows
keydiver chipped ecu, 2g maf, Dejon intake, RC 550cc injectors, Rewired Walbro 255, Bastard 20g, 3g lifters.
